Movatterモバイル変換


[0]ホーム

URL:


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

Commitbbdc794

Browse files
authored
Merge v1.2.2 into main (#17037)
This brings in the latest changes in `v1.2-histrionicus` into `main`.The more complex bit was merging `.github/config/out_of_tree.cmake`,that is still likely will not really compile due to patches beingapplied to different commits.Four regressions:* httpfs had sha c22532453e9fab8404f91729708d9f35e23d323d in `v1.2.2`,rolling back a few commits to `85ac4667bcb0d868199e156f8dd918b0278db7b9`due to changes in Secret interface* `avro` is currently disabled, needs a patch and re-enabling* `delta` is currently disabled, needs a different set of patches andre-enabling* `aws` tests are currently skippedAnd an unrelated change, that was needed due to incompatibility:* bump spatial and remove the patchThere are relevant issues to solve them and can be handled piece bypiece.
2 parents5141aa4 +7997d80 commitbbdc794

File tree

23 files changed

+218
-316
lines changed

23 files changed

+218
-316
lines changed

‎.github/actions/build_extensions/action.yml‎

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-88,9 +88,6 @@ inputs:
8888
description:'Flags to be passed to cmake'
8989
default:''
9090

91-
env:
92-
CMAKE_POLICY_VERSION_MINIMUM:3.5
93-
9491
runs:
9592
using:"composite"
9693
steps:

‎.github/actions/build_extensions_dockerized/action.yml‎

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-59,7 +59,6 @@ runs:
5959
echo "OPENSSL_DIR=/duckdb_build_dir/build/release/vcpkg_installed/${{ inputs.vcpkg_target_triplet }}" >> docker_env.txt
6060
echo "OPENSSL_USE_STATIC_LIBS=true" >> docker_env.txt
6161
echo "DUCKDB_PLATFORM=${{ inputs.duckdb_arch }}" >> docker_env.txt
62-
echo "CMAKE_POLICY_VERSION_MINIMUM=3.5" >> docker_env.txt
6362
echo "OVERRIDE_GIT_DESCRIBE=${{ inputs.override_git_describe }}" >> docker_env.txt
6463
echo "LINUX_CI_IN_DOCKER=1" >> docker_env.txt
6564
echo "TOOLCHAIN_FLAGS=${{ inputs.duckdb_arch == 'linux_arm64' && '-DCMAKE_C_COMPILER=aarch64-linux-gnu-gcc -DCMAKE_CXX_COMPILER=aarch64-linux-gnu-g++ -DCMAKE_Fortran_COMPILER=aarch64-linux-gnu-gfortran' || '' }}" >> docker_env.txt

‎.github/config/out_of_tree_extensions.cmake‎

Lines changed: 24 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-28,12 +28,24 @@ duckdb_extension_load(httpfs
2828
INCLUDE_DIR extension/httpfs/include
2929
)
3030

31+
### Skip due to missing patch
32+
if(FALSE)
33+
################# AVRO
34+
if (NOT MINGW)
35+
duckdb_extension_load(avro
36+
LOAD_TESTS DONT_LINK
37+
GIT_URL https://github.com/duckdb/duckdb-avro
38+
GIT_TAG ed18629fa56a97e0796a3582110b51ddd125159d
39+
)
40+
endif()
41+
endif()
42+
3143
################## AWS
3244
if (NOT MINGWANDNOT${WASM_ENABLED})
3345
duckdb_extension_load(aws
34-
LOAD_TESTS
46+
### TODO: re-enableLOAD_TESTS
3547
GIT_URL https://github.com/duckdb/duckdb-aws
36-
GIT_TAGb3050f35c6e99fa35465230493eeab14a78a0409
48+
GIT_TAGe92e45b30ba17594b1101db22699a2244adfaeb1
3749
APPLY_PATCHES
3850
)
3951
endif()
@@ -43,7 +55,7 @@ if (NOT MINGW AND NOT ${WASM_ENABLED})
4355
duckdb_extension_load(azure
4456
LOAD_TESTS
4557
GIT_URL https://github.com/duckdb/duckdb-azure
46-
GIT_TAGe707cf361d76358743969cddf3acf97cfc87677b
58+
GIT_TAG1593cb56745a51eb7d8415c1fd7d11a15f20f413
4759
)
4860
endif()
4961

@@ -54,6 +66,7 @@ if (FALSE)
5466
if (NOT MINGWANDNOT"${OS_NAME}"STREQUAL"linux"ANDNOT${WASM_ENABLED})
5567
duckdb_extension_load(delta
5668
GIT_URL https://github.com/duckdb/duckdb-delta
69+
## TODO: GIT_TAG 90f244b3d572c1692867950b562df8183957b7a8
5770
GIT_TAG 6d626173e9efa6615c25eb08d979d1372100d5db
5871
APPLY_PATCHES
5972
)
@@ -64,14 +77,13 @@ endif()
6477
duckdb_extension_load(excel
6578
LOAD_TESTS
6679
GIT_URL https://github.com/duckdb/duckdb-excel
67-
GIT_TAGf14e7c3beaf379c54b47b996aa896a1d814e1be8
80+
GIT_TAGb724b308b2b3a3c5644272cc84ec140fbcc7617d
6881
INCLUDE_DIR src/excel/include
6982
)
7083

7184
################# ICEBERG
7285
# Windows tests for iceberg currently not working
73-
if(FALSE)
74-
if (NOTWIN32)
86+
IF (NOTWIN32)
7587
set(LOAD_ICEBERG_TESTS"LOAD_TESTS")
7688
else ()
7789
set(LOAD_ICEBERG_TESTS"")
@@ -81,10 +93,9 @@ if (NOT MINGW AND NOT ${WASM_ENABLED} AND NOT ${MUSL_ENABLED})
8193
duckdb_extension_load(iceberg
8294
# ${LOAD_ICEBERG_TESTS} TODO: re-enable once autoloading test is fixed
8395
GIT_URL https://github.com/duckdb/duckdb-iceberg
84-
GIT_TAG43b4e37f6e859d6c1c67b787ac511659e9e0b6fb
96+
GIT_TAG2db98c685f67373b347c3a8c435ef2e01c509697
8597
)
8698
endif()
87-
endif()
8899

89100
################# INET
90101
duckdb_extension_load(inet
@@ -103,7 +114,7 @@ if (NOT MINGW AND NOT ${WASM_ENABLED})
103114
duckdb_extension_load(postgres_scanner
104115
DONT_LINK
105116
GIT_URL https://github.com/duckdb/duckdb-postgres
106-
GIT_TAG8461ed8b6f726564934e9c831cdc88d431e3148f
117+
GIT_TAG98482ce5c144287f01e738275892cdb84ea9b5ce
107118
APPLY_PATCHES
108119
)
109120
endif()
@@ -114,10 +125,9 @@ if (NOT MINGW)
114125
duckdb_extension_load(spatial
115126
DONT_LINK LOAD_TESTS
116127
GIT_URL https://github.com/duckdb/duckdb-spatial
117-
GIT_TAG2905968a85703e5ca3698976daafd759554e1744
128+
GIT_TAG4be6065edc313a53ff2196ff79c11a0d5e249720
118129
INCLUDE_DIR spatial/include
119130
TEST_DIRtest/sql
120-
APPLY_PATCHES
121131
)
122132
endif()
123133

@@ -132,7 +142,7 @@ endif()
132142
duckdb_extension_load(sqlite_scanner
133143
${STATIC_LINK_SQLITE} LOAD_TESTS
134144
GIT_URL https://github.com/duckdb/duckdb-sqlite
135-
GIT_TAG96e451c043afa40ee39b7581009ba0c72a523a12
145+
GIT_TAG66a5fa2448398379dc21c18308e3b95d42d84015
136146
APPLY_PATCHES
137147
)
138148

@@ -147,7 +157,7 @@ duckdb_extension_load(vss
147157
LOAD_TESTS
148158
DONT_LINK
149159
GIT_URL https://github.com/duckdb/duckdb-vss
150-
GIT_TAG580e8918eb89f478cf2d233ca908ffbd3ec752c5
160+
GIT_TAGba199a7215b75e83821ece13f6b921ccfcebd6ac
151161
TEST_DIRtest/sql
152162
APPLY_PATCHES
153163
)
@@ -158,7 +168,7 @@ if (NOT MINGW AND NOT ${WASM_ENABLED} AND NOT ${MUSL_ENABLED})
158168
DONT_LINK
159169
LOAD_TESTS
160170
GIT_URL https://github.com/duckdb/duckdb-mysql
161-
GIT_TAGc2a56813a9fe9cb8c24c424be646d41ab2f8e64f
171+
GIT_TAG93469fc39a317acf916627e0ddc724a076bf7302
162172
APPLY_PATCHES
163173
)
164174
endif()

0 commit comments

Comments
 (0)

[8]ページ先頭

©2009-2025 Movatter.jp